2. Description of the Related Art In recent years, high-temperature rapid processing has become widespread in the process of developing photographic light-sensitive materials using silver halide. In the case of processing using an automatic developing machine, the processing speed is high, and the shorter the processing time, the greater the number of processed sheets per unit time and the greater the economic effect. Therefore, photosensitive material manufacturers are making efforts to raise the processing temperature of development and fixing so that processing can be performed in a shorter time. However, since the processing speed is short, the conveying speed of the photographic photosensitive material in the automatic developing machine is also increased, so that the development unevenness during the development processing, the fixing unevenness during the fixing processing, the fixing failure and the like are likely to occur.

[0003] Each of these phenomena significantly impairs the commercial value, and in some cases, causes the commercial value to be completely lost.
It is also one of the very troublesome problems that is noticed only after the development processing. In order to solve these problems, as a countermeasure in automatic developing machines, efforts have been made to completely immerse the transport rollers in the processing liquid and to eliminate the transport rollers above the liquid level using guides. However, there are many problems in transportability, and it is difficult to further increase the speed.

A typical example of the compound represented by formula 6 used in the present invention is 2-hydroxy-4,6-
Examples include sodium dichlorotriazine, which is generally called a triazine hardener. It is preferred to add 1 to 500 mg of triazine hardener in 1 g of gelatin,
Particularly, 10 mg to 100 mg is preferable. When added immediately before coating, the effect of the hardening is further enhanced. It may be diffused into the emulsion layer in addition to the layer adjacent to the emulsion layer. The triazine hardener may be used alone or in combination with another hardener.

(5) The compositions of the developing solution and the fixing solution are as follows. <Developer> Potassium hydroxide 17 g Sodium sulfite 60 g Diethylenetriaminepentaacetic acid 2 g Potassium carbonate 5 g Boric acid 3 g Hydroquinone 35 g Diethylene glycol 12 g 4-Hydroxymethyl-4-methyl-1-phenyl-3-pyrazolidone 1.65 g 5-methylbenzotriazole 0.0 g 6 g Acetic acid 1.8 g Potassium bromide 2 g Make up to 1 l with water (adjust to pH 10.50)

【0040】 <定着液> チオ硫酸アンモニウム 140g 亜硫酸ナトリウム 15g エチレンジアミン四酢酸・二ナトリウム・2水塩 25mg 水酸化ナトリウム 6g 水で1lとする(酢酸でpH=4.95に調整する)<Fixing Solution> Ammonium thiosulfate 140 g Sodium sulfite 15 g 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id disodium dihydrate 25 mg Sodium hydroxide 6 g Make up to 1 l with water (adjust to pH = 4.95 with acetic acid)
